Transaction ec17536ebc559e6ffc951ea4f09268d025d96d199ca1ca318e515118b226211e
1 Input
1 Output
-
ec17536ebc559e6ffc951ea4f09268d025d96d199ca1ca318e515118b226211e:0
- value
- 26912
- script pubkey
- OP_0 OP_PUSHBYTES_20 2e92855a8c78c16923f6bc1a4dced56a6d871b03
- address
- bc1q96fg2k5v0rqkjglkhsdymnk4dfkcwxcr563hur